首页主机资讯Debian spool中的缓存文件怎么清理

Debian spool中的缓存文件怎么清理

时间2025-10-30 01:15:03发布访客分类主机资讯浏览294
导读:在Debian系统中,/var/spool 目录通常用于存储各种服务和应用程序的临时文件。这些文件可能包括邮件、打印队列等。清理 /var/spool 中的缓存文件需要谨慎操作,因为误删重要文件可能导致服务故障。 以下是一些常见的清理步骤:...

在Debian系统中,/var/spool 目录通常用于存储各种服务和应用程序的临时文件。这些文件可能包括邮件、打印队列等。清理 /var/spool 中的缓存文件需要谨慎操作,因为误删重要文件可能导致服务故障。

以下是一些常见的清理步骤:

1. 清理邮件缓存

如果你使用的是Postfix或Sendmail等邮件服务,可以清理邮件缓存文件:

sudo rm -rf /var/spool/postfix/*
sudo rm -rf /var/spool/sendmail/*

2. 清理打印队列

如果你使用的是CUPS打印服务,可以清理打印队列:

sudo lpstat -p -d  # 查看打印队列
sudo cancel -a     # 取消所有打印任务
sudo rm -rf /var/spool/cups/*

3. 清理APT缓存

APT包管理器的缓存文件通常存储在 /var/cache/apt/archives 目录下:

sudo apt-get clean

或者手动删除缓存文件:

sudo rm -rf /var/cache/apt/archives/*

4. 清理系统日志缓存

系统日志缓存文件通常存储在 /var/log 目录下,但有些日志文件可能会被轮转存储在其他位置,如 /var/log/syslog/var/log/messages。你可以使用 logrotate 工具来管理日志文件的轮转和清理。

5. 清理临时文件

系统临时文件通常存储在 /tmp 目录下:

sudo rm -rf /tmp/*

注意事项

  • 在删除任何文件之前,请确保这些文件不是系统或服务运行所必需的。
  • 使用 sudo 命令以管理员权限执行操作。
  • 定期清理缓存文件可以释放磁盘空间,但不要过于频繁地清理,以免影响系统性能。

如果你不确定某个文件是否可以删除,可以先备份该文件,然后再进行删除操作。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Debian spool中的缓存文件怎么清理
本文地址: https://pptw.com/jishu/738425.html
Debian spool如何确保数据安全 debian虚拟机如何备份与恢复数据

游客 回复需填写必要信息